Abstract

The aim of this study to screen the various phytochemicals present in the methanolic extracts of the oven dried leaves of Chenopodium ambrosioides, Chenopodium album, Polygonum barbatum and Polygonum lanigerum using GC-MS. The major compound present in C. ambrosioides is ergosta-7, 2, 2-dien-3-ol, (3beta, 22 E). In C. album the major compound detected are naphthalene, decahydro-1, 1, 4a-trimethyl-6-methylene-5-(3-methylene4-pentenyl)-[4aS-(4a alpha, 5alpha, 8abeta)]. Pentamethylmelamine is the major compound present in the P. barbatum. Stigmast-5-en-3-ol, (3beta)-24 beta-ethyl-5-delta-cholesten-3 beta-ol is the major compound found in P. lanigerum.
